Abstract: We calculate one-loop scattering amplitudes for gravitons and two-forms in dimensions greater than four. The string based Kawai-Lewellen-Tye relationships allow gravitons and two-forms to be treated in a unified manner. We use the results to determine the ultra-violet infinities present in these amplitudes and show how these determine the renormalised one-loop action in six and eight dimensions.
